Dorothy M. Lamprecht

Funeral services for Dorothy M. Lamprecht, 85, of Chickasha, will be held Monday, September 8, 2003, at 10:30 a.m. in the Ferguson Funeral Home Chapel, with Jerl Joslin and David Woods officiating.

Dorothy M. Lamprecht was born June 1, 1918, daughter of Will and Rosia (Tindel) Berry. She died September 3, 2003, in Chickasha, after an extended illness.

Dorothy was one of nine children and grew up in the Chickasha area. She married Henry G. "Hank" Lamprecht in Purcell, Oklahoma, on August 9, 1939. They made their home in Chickasha, where Dorothy lived most of her life.

Dorothy was an active member of the Parkview Christian Church.

She enjoyed arts and crafts, especially making ceramics, raising flowers, and gardening.

She was preceded in death by her husband of 62 years, "Hank," and her daughter Sharon Lamprecht Flick.

Survivors include her son and daughter-in-law, Curtis and Pam Lamprecht, of Denver, Colorado; two grandchildren: Rachel Axton, of Norman, Oklahoma, and John Flick of Wilmington, North Carolina; one great grandchild, Lauren Axton of Norman, Oklahoma; two brothers and sisters-in- law: Harvey and Betty Berry and Jack and Pauline Berry, both of Ninnekah, Oklahoma; one sister, Vera Collins of Chickasha; and numerous nieces and nephews.

In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to Parkview Christian Church, P. O. Box 279, Chickasha, Oklahoma 73023.

Per Dorothy's request the casket will be closed at the funeral home and the service.

Interment will be in the Ninnekah Cemetery under the direction of Ferguson Funeral Home.
